With kernel 5.3 in Eoan a new feature called thin provisioning for DASD devices got introduced.
It turned out that may cause potential data corruption.
Hence it got on short notice disabled (reverted) in Eoans kernel 5.3 (this is already done),
but this upstream accepted patch now fixes it for Focals kernel 5.4.
